深入探索区块链平台模式
2025-10-18
区块链技术在过去几年中得到了飞速的发展,成为了数字经济的核心组成部分。随着区块链在各行各业的应用增多,出现了多种区块链平台模式。选择一种合适的区块链平台模式,不仅关系到项目的成功与否,还直接影响到应用的性能、安全性及用户体验。
区块链平台是一个支持区块链技术实施的基础设施,通常提供了一系列的工具和功能,帮助开发者构建去中心化应用(dApps)。这些平台支持智能合约、数字资产创建、记账系统等功能。比特币和以太坊是最早的区块链平台,但随着技术的发展,涌现出许多新的平台,如Hyperledger、EOS、Algorand等。
根据不同的应用需求和技术架构,区块链平台模式可以大致分为以下几种:
公有链是完全开放的,任何人都可以查看和参与。这种模式非常适合需要透明性和去中心化的应用。例如,比特币和以太坊都是公有链,它们允许任何用户进行交易、发布智能合约和创建代币。
公有链的优点在于安全性和不可篡改性,但缺点也很明显,主要表现为交易速度慢和扩展性差。因此,在选择公有链模式时,开发者需要考虑到应用的具体需求,以及如何设计扩展解决方案。
私有链是由某个组织或小团队管理的区块链,参与者需经过许可才能接入。这种模式适合企业内部应用,能有效控制敏感数据的安全性。
私有链的主要优点包括交易速度快、隐私性高,但其去中心化的特性较差,无法充分利用区块链的优势。因此,很多企业在考虑私有链时,通常会对其安全机制和信任模型进行深入分析。
联盟链是一种介于公有链和私有链之间的模式,由几个组织组成联盟,共同维护区块链网络。这种模式适用一些行业应用,如供应链管理、金融服务等。
联盟链能够较好地平衡隐私与透明性,同时提高交易的速度和效率。然而,建立这样的联盟需要多个组织之间的信任和合作,这也为实施带来了挑战。
混合链结合了公有链和私有链的特性,允许用户根据需要自由选择公共或私有交易。这种灵活性使得混合链能够适用于更多的场景,如跨境支付、版权保护等。
不过,由于混合链的复杂性,开发和维护的成本相对较高,开发团队需具备扎实的技术背景。
选择适合的区块链平台模式需要考虑以下几个因素:
去中心化特性是区块链安全性的核心之一。由于区块链网络不依赖于单一的中心节点,任何参与节点都能对链上数据及其变更进行校验,这大大提高了数据的不可篡改性和透明性。
在没有去中心化的情况下,单点故障可能导致数据被篡改或删除。去中心化通过将数据分散存储在多个节点上,增加了篡改数据的难度,攻击者需要同时控制大量节点,难度非常高。
然而,去中心化也带来了一些挑战。比如,交易确认时间可能会延长,且网络性能会受到节点数量的限制。因此,在设计区块链应用时,需要综合考虑去中心化与性能之间的平衡。
区块链平台的交易速度是影响用户体验的重要因素。为了提高交易速度,开发者可以考虑以下几个策略:
不同的策略适用于不同的应用场景,开发者需要根据实际需求选择合适的解决方案。
区块链的快速发展给法律合规带来了挑战,包括数据隐私、交易法规及跨境交易问题。为了解决这些法律合规问题,可以采取以下措施:
通过以上措施,企业能够在合规的基础上推动区块链技术的应用和发展。
区块链在供应链管理中的应用潜力巨大,能够有效解决现有供应链的透明性不足、效率低下等问题。具体优势体现在以下几个方面:
以上这些优势使得越来越多的企业开始探索区块链在供应链管理中的实际应用,包括物流、产品溯源等领域。
区块链技术仍处于快速发展之中,其未来的发展趋势可以通过以下几个方面进行预测:
总体来看,区块链技术的未来将更加多元化,应用场景也将不断拓宽,为各行各业带来新的机遇和挑战。
区块链平台模式的选择不仅仅是技术问题,更是商业模型和战略规划的重要组成部分。开发者和企业需要根据自身的需求、目标以及市场环境,精心选择合适的区块链平台模式,并积极应对技术、法律和市场变化带来的挑战。随着区块链技术的不断发展,未来将会有更多创新的应用模式涌现,为我们的生活和经济活动带来深远的影响。